    Job Description

PROGRAM ASSOCIATE, Open Space Programming (https://www.openspace.mit.edu/) , to work closely as part of a team to plan for upcoming events and coordinate event support services with vendors inside and outside MIT. Will set up, staff, and break down indoor and outdoor events; provide administrative support for multiple events, program, and projects; create signage; create, update, and monitor event paperwork; maintain an inventory of event supplies; coordinate after-hours access to E38 for events; attend meetings with current and potential collaborators, vendors, and caterers; provide backup staffing for the MIT Welcome Center desk as needed; and perform other duties as assigned. Will take direction from the leadership team and the program manager.

Job Requirements

REQUIRED: high school diploma or its equivalent; at least three years of administrative or event support experience; excellent event coordination, organizational, customer service, interpersonal, and verbal communication skills; experience using good judgment and tact while working with the public; attention to detail and accuracy; ability to prioritize, work on multiple tasks simultaneously, and meet deadlines with minimal supervision; demonstrated flexibility when there is a need to change, reprioritize, or shift focus/goals; willingness to learn MIT processes and systems; and ability to move weights of 10 to 20 lbs., traverse long distances, and travel from site to site. Seek a collaborative team player with an interest in public programs and community engagement who supports Open Space Programming’s committed to inclusive practices and meaningful community engagement and enjoys interacting with a wide variety of people, including tourists, prospective students, their families, and the general public. PREFERRED: bachelor’s degree, spoken Spanish language skills, and experience in an office/professional environment. Job #24243-5 This role requires working a flexible schedule, including regular night and weekend work for programs and events and regular business hours on non-event days. This is an on-site role with one day of remote work possible.Hourly rate range: $25.00-$29.00 7/22/24
